Cecil B. DeMille
The American film-maker Cecil B. DeMille was one of the most famous of the early film directors. He was the first to deal with social issues, in films such as Manslaughter (1921). His spectacular epics, including The Ten Commandments (1956), were also landmarks in the history of cinema.
